lopper
noun
/ˈlɒpər/

Definition
A lopper is a tool used primarily for trimming or cutting branches and stems.

Examples
- She used her lopper to trim the overgrown bushes in the garden.
- For thicker branches, it’s best to use a lopper instead of a standard pair of clippers.
- The lopper made the task of pruning much easier and efficient.

Meaning
Loppers are large pruning shears that provide a longer handle than standard pruning shears, allowing for greater leverage when cutting thick or hard-to-reach branches.
